ED card and Sustainability Fee

Every traveller to Aruba must complete the online ED card (Embarkation/Disembarkation card) before arrival. Most visitors also pay a Sustainability Fee of $20.

Only use the official website: edcardaruba.aw. Unofficial websites charge extra "service fees" for the same form.

What is the ED card?

The ED card is Aruba's mandatory online entry form. You enter your personal details, flight details and where you are staying. After submitting it you receive a confirmation with a QR code. Your airline checks the ED card before boarding, and border officers use it on arrival.

Sustainability Fee ($20)

Since 2024 visitors pay a Sustainability Fee of $20 per person, which you pay online together with the ED card. The money is used to protect Aruba's nature and to keep the island clean.
